... Phúc.Đề tài :Không giantrạngthái được mô tả là trò chơi cờ tướng. Hãy xây dựng chương trình giải quyết bài toán theo phương pháp cắt tỉa alpha-beta. Để mô tả khônggiantrạngthái của 1, ... trị cha của từng node, mảng con để xác định node đó làlá của cây hay là đỉnh kết thúc.Thuật toán cắt tỉa Alpha-Beta:Ý tưởng này được gọi là nguyên tắc Alpha-Beta do nó dùng trong thủ tụcAlphaBetaHai ... truyền thống) được gọi là alpha và beta và dùng để theo dõi các triển vọng - chúng cho biết các giá trị nằm ngoài khoảng [alpha, beta] là các điểm "thật sự tồi" và không cần phải xem...
... chỉ chứa trạngthái đầuLoop do If L rỗng then {thông báo thất bại; stop;} Loại trạngthái u ở đầu danh sách L; If u làtrạngthái đích then {thông báo thành công; stop;} For trạngthái v kề ... đó thì A* là đầy đủiii.Nếu H(u) = 0 với mọi u, thuật toán A* chính là thuật toán tìm kiếm tốt nhất đầu tiên với hàm đánh giá G(u).Báo cáoĐề tài: Khônggiantrạngthái được mô tả là bài toán ... Đề tài: Khônggiantrạngthái được mô tả là bài toán n-queens. Hãy xây dựng chương trình cho phép đưa ra lời giải của...
... toán (hai vòng for ở chương trình chính) là cỡ n. Thủ tục DFS phải thực hiện không quá n lần. Tổng số phép toán cần phaỉ thực hiện trong các thủ tục này là O(n+m), do trong các thủ tục này ta ... kiếm từ các đỉnh chưa được thăm, vì vậy, nó sẽ xét qua tất cả các đỉnh của đồ thị (không nhất thiết phải là liên thông).Để đánh giá độ phức tạp tính toán của thủ tục, trước hết nhận thấy rằng ... đến thăm tất cả các đỉnh thuộc cùng thành phần liên thông với đỉnh v, bởi vì sau khi thăm đỉnh là lệnh gọi đến thủ tục DFS đối với tất cả các đỉnh kề với nó. Mặt khác, do mỗi khi thăm đỉnh v...
... !"#$%&'(#)* Khônggiantrạngthái được mô tả là bài toán n-queens. Hãy xây dựng chương trình giải quyết bài toán theogiải thuật gene với phương pháp chọn là Elitism. Giảng viên ... cho số lượng các quân hậu ăn nhau là ít nhất (hay tức làkhông có quân hậunào ăn nhau cả). Hãy giải quyết bài toán bằng thủ thuật gene với phương pháp chọn là Elitism.• Ý tưởng: Ta tiến hành ... trạng thái của bàn cờ ta mã hóa chúng thành các gen (gọi là các mảng 1 chiều) cho các gen đó lai ghép vói nhau để tạo ra các gen mới kiểm tra trong số các gen của chúng ta xem có gen nào là...
... Biểu diễn khônggiantrạng thái Hoàng Anh VũBước đầu để giải quyết các bài toán Trí Tuệ Nhân Tạo Trước hết ta cần định nghĩa 'Biểu diễn khônggiantrạngthái (KGTT)' là gì. Biểu diễn ... diễn trạngthái ban đầu. - Biểu diễn một cách chính xác khi một trạngthái thỏa mãn đích của bài toán. - Kích hoạt các luật sinh từ trạngthái ban đầu và các trạngthái tiếp theo cho đến khi trạng ... so sánh trạngthái hiện thời với các luật để sinh ra trạngthái kế tiếp. Các trạngthái này có thể được lưu vào một QUEUE (tống quát) nào đó chẳng hạn, cho đến khi tìm được trạngthái đích,...
... và cài đặt tìm kiếm trong khônggiantrạngthái phát sinh trạng thái. Trong tìm kiếm theo đệ quy đối với một trạngthái con, nếu có một con nào đó của trạngthái này là đích, thuật toán đệ quy ... trúc tìm kiếm khônggian trạng thái. Các trạngthái kế tiếp của bộ nhớ làm việc sẽ tạo nên các nút của đồ thị. Các luật sinh là các bước chuyển đổi có thể xảy ra giữa các trạngthái cùng với ... một trạngthái duy nhất cùng với các con của nó thay vì phải duy trì một danh sách open gồm nhiều trạng thái. Tìm kiếm trong khônggiantrạngtháilà một quá trình đệ quy. Để tìm đường đi từ trạng...
... j, j)(i, j, i)4. Khônggiantrạngthái của bài toán.4 Kkhông giantrạngtháilà tập tất cả các trạngthái có thể có và tập các toán tửcủa bài toán. Không giantrạngtháilà một bộ bốn, Ký ... Trạng thái đầu là (1,1,. . .,1) Trạng thái cuối là (3,3,. . .,3)3. Toán tử chuyển trạng thái. Toán tử chuyển trạngthái thực chất là các phép biến đổi đưa từ trạngthái nàysang trạngthái khác. ... giải trong khônggiantrạngtháilà quá trình tìm kiếm xuất phát từ trạng thái ban đầu, dựa vào toán tử chuyển trạngthái để xác định các trạng thái tiếp theo cho đến khi gặp được trạngthái đích.5....
... ta sử dụng hàm đánh giá, ký hiệu là h với ý nghĩa: h(u) cho biết số các chữ số trong trạngthái u không trùng với vị trí cú nó trong trạng thái đích. Trạngthái có tiềm năng dẫn đến đích nhanh ... trên7212236545683347∞∞∞∞∞∞∞∞∞∞∞∞∞∞0263205850368307370440- Hàm h2: Gọi h2(u) làlà tổng khoảng cách giữa vị trí của các quân trong trạng thái u và vị trí của nó trong trạngthái đích. Ở đây, khoảng cách được hiểu là số lần dịch chuyển ít nhất ... thác khônggian bài toán. Chúng đều vét cạn khônggian để tìm ra lời giải theo thủ tục xác định trước. Mặc dù có sử dụng tri thức về trạngthái của bài toán để hướng dẫn tìm kiếm nhưng không...
... trong không gian trạng thái. Không giantrạng thái. Khônggian n chiều mà trục toạ độ gồm có trục x1, trục x2,…, xn là các biến trạng thái, thì được gọi làkhônggiantrạng thái. Bất kì trạng ... định nghóa trạng thái, biến trạng thái, vectơ trạngthái và khônggiantrạng thái. Trạng thái. Trạngthái của moat hệ thống động là tập hợp nhỏ nhất của các biến (được gọilà biến trạng thái) để ... mà hoặc không đo lường hay quan sát được thì có thể được chọn như biến trạng thái. Sự chọn tự do biến trạngtháilà moat thuận lợi của phương pháp khônggiantrạng thái. Vectơ trạng thái. Nếu...
... môn trí tuệ nhân tạo Không có quá trình nào làkhông thể kết thúc. Quá trình tiếnhóa có thể dừng lại sau một khoảng tgian được quy định(mộtsố thế hệ) hoặc sau khi đã hội tụ (không thể tìm thêm ... VIỆN KỸ THUẬT QUÂN SỰBÀI TẬP LỚN MÔN TRÍ TUỆ NHÂN TẠOĐề bài: Xây dựng chương trình mô tả khônggiantrạngthái của toán chiếcbalô loại 2 giải quyết theo giải thuật Gene với phương pháp chọn Rank.Sinh ... bị một số thứ. Tuy nhiên,bạn không thể đem tất cả đi được vì sức người có hạn. Bạn phảiđem theo đồ gì, số lượng mỗi loại là bao nhiêu để đạt được tổng giátrị là lớn nhất nhưng vẫn trong khả...
... biểu diễn khônggiantrạngthái của bài toán- Textbox: để nhập vào số thành phố - Nút khởi tạo: khởi tạo các trọng số (khoảng cách giữa 2 thành phố)- Nút Generate để vẽ khônggiantrạngthái của ... đủ thì đó là bài toán không có lời giải. Dừng thuật toán.- TH3: Hoặc sau khi đến thành phố thứ n (không phải thành phố xuất phát) mà không còn đường đi tiếp thì đấy cũng là bài toán không có ... thuật toán: đây là giải thuật mang tính local, không kèm theo sự ước lượng và phán đoán. Do đó lời giải của bài toàn thường làkhông tối ưu. Và thuật toán dễ rơi vào vòng lặp không thoát ra...
... với trạngthái cụ thể. IV. Lời cuốiKhuôn khổ bản đồ án chỉ dừng lại ở mức độ minh họa thuật toán đối với khônggiantrạngthái cụ thể là bàn cờ vua. Trong quá trình xây dựng chương trình, không ... độ sâu được xét tới là 3.Giao diện chương trình:Màn hình đăng nhập người chơiHọc viện Kỹ thuật quân sựKhoa CNTTĐồ án Nhập môn trí tuệ nhân tạo Không giantrạngtháilà trò chơi cờ vua. Xây ... , ) nh sau:function MaxVal(u, , );beginif u làlá của cây hạn chế hoặc u là đỉnh kết thúcthen MaxVal eval(u)else for mỗi đỉnh v là con của u do{ max[, MinVal(v, , )];...
... đen. Ở đây em thực hiện mô tả khônggiantrạngthái trò chơi cờ tướng theo giải thuật minimax.Mặc dù em đã cố gắng mô tả các luật đi của các quân cờ, xong vẫn không thể tránh khỏi các thiếu ... quân cờ nào không? Nếu có thì không thể đi được. Hàm trả về false.Tương tự đối với đi xuống, đi sang trái hoặc đi sang phải. Nếu có quân cờ giữa điểm cần di chuyển và điểm đến thì không thể đi ... D1); ArrayToaDoDiem.Add(td); } } }Ở đây em quy định D là độ rộng của ô theo chiều ngang, D1 là độ rộng các ô theo chiều dọc.td là 1 đối tượng thuộc class ToaDoiDiem. Duyệt từng tọa độ của...
... toán hơn là xây dựng một chương trình cótính ứng dụng cao trong thực tế.II. Cơ sở lí thuyếtVấn đề chơi cờ có thể xem xét như vấn đề tìm kiếm trong không giantrạng thái. Mỗi trạngtháilà một ... các quân cờ trên bàn cờ).- Trạngthái ban đầu là sự sắp xếp các quân cờ của hai bên lúcbắt đầu chơi.- Các toán tử là các nước đi hợp lệ.- Các trạngthái kết thúc là các tình thế mà cuộc chơi ... đỉnh A là đen, trong trường hợp này, nếu eval (U)<eval(V) ta cũng có thể cắt bỏ cây con gốc A.Học viện Kỹ thuật quân sựKhoa CNTTĐồ án Nhập môn trí tuệ nhân tạo Không giantrạngtháilà trò...